Understanding Pain Relief Remedies
Pain relief remedies can be broadly classified into 3 primary types: medications, topical treatments, and alternative therapies. Each category has its own set of benefits and disadvantages, customized to various levels of pain and client requirements.
1. Medications
Medications are amongst the most common kinds of pain relief. They can be further divided into over the counter (OTC) options and prescription medications.
TypeExamplesDescriptionWhen to UseOTC Pain RelieversAcetaminophen, Ibuprofen, AspirinThese are extensively offered and effective for mild to moderate pain.Headaches, muscle pains, small arthritis.Prescription MedicationsOpioids (e.g., Morphine, Oxycodone)Stronger painkiller prescribed by doctors, typically for extreme pain.Surgery recovery, cancer pain, severe injury.2. Topical Treatments
Topical treatments involve creams, gels, and patches that can be applied directly to the skin. They are useful for localized pain relief.
TypeExamplesDescriptionWhen to UseCreams and GelsCapsaicin, DiclofenacNon-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) applied on the skin.Arthritis, muscle pains.PatchesLidocaine, FentanylAdhesive spots that deliver medication gradually.Persistent pain management.3. Alternative Therapies
These treatments might assist reduce pain without the use of medications and can be complementary to traditional therapies.

What's the difference in between OTC and prescription pain relievers?
Answer: OTC Pain Relief Supplements relievers are offered without a prescription and are typically used for mild to moderate pain. Prescription medications are stronger and may be needed for serious or chronic pain however featured greater threats of adverse effects and dependence.
2. Can I utilize multiple pain relief methods simultaneously?
Answer: Yes, many individuals discover relief utilizing a combination of techniques, such as taking OTC painkiller while going through physical therapy. However, Medication Delivery Usa it's necessary to consult with a health care service provider to prevent prospective interactions.
3. Are there adverse effects to using topical pain relief creams?
Answer: While topical treatments normally have fewer negative effects than oral medications, they can cause skin irritation or allergies in some people. Constantly perform a spot test before extensive use.
4. The length of time does it take for pain relief medications to work?
Answer: The time it considers pain relief medications to work can vary. OTC medications usually take 30 minutes to an hour, while more powerful prescription medications might take longer, depending upon the type.
5. What should I do if my pain persists in spite of utilizing pain relief remedies?
Answer: If pain persists in spite of treatment, it's important to look for medical suggestions. Consistent pain can be an indication of a hidden condition that needs more focused treatment.
